New York State Permits SoFi to Sell Cryptocurrencies
by Fioney Staff
Empire State residents will now have another option for trading cryptocurrencies. This week the New York State Department of Financial Services approved FinTech lender turned jack-of-all-trades SoFi for a BitLicense. The move means that users in the state will now be able to buy and sell crypto on the SoFi Invest platform. Personal Loans Still Fastest-Growing Debt Type in U.S.
by Fioney Staff
Looking for a personal loan this holiday season? You're certainly not alone. According to a recent Experian report, personal loans continue to be the fastest-growing type of debt, totaling $305 billion in the second quarter of this year. That marks a 12% year over year increase and a 47% rise from 2015 when personal loan debt stood at $208.5 billion. Additionally Experian found that 11% of Americans now have an active...
